九宫图的启发式搜索算法程序和广度搜索算法程序及报告
2021-08-18 16:11:51 518KB 九宫图 启发式搜索 广度优先搜索
1
广度优先遍历4叉树,可以在3秒以内还原任何九宫格拼图,并附带验证程序 算法经过多次改进,个人认为已经达到了非常优异的性能,有什么好的思路或者疑问,欢迎交流。 具体实现过程是:把当前状态移动一步的下一个状态放入队列,每次从队列中取操作步聚出来验证,如果图没有拼好,则生成下一步的所有状态(最多4种),将它们放入队列 最复杂的情况是 087654321,一共要28步才可以拼好;即任何一个图都可以在28步(含)以内拼好。
2021-08-09 14:22:39 15KB 拼图 算法 破解 还原
1
Big Data Deep and Broad Learning Myth on Big Data Broad Learning Type of Broad Learning Real World Examples Mobile User Identification Using Behavioral Biometrics for Mobile user Identification Multi-view Data Challenges View of Alphabet Typing Behavior View of Symbol/Number Typing Behavior View of Acceleration Behavior Concatenation Late Fusion Approach Identification between Any Pair of Users N-active Shard User Identification Summary
2021-08-08 13:00:31 868KB 大数据 机器学习 广度学习 数据挖掘
c++ 数据结构 有向图的深度 广度 遍历 全代码 参考资料 任燕版 数据结构
2021-08-07 20:03:19 2KB 有向图 广度 深度 数据结构
1
分别使用广度优先搜索、深度优先搜索和 A*算法实现重排九宫格问题; 使用的搜索方式可在程序内修改; 可以自行输入初始状态和目标状态 可以选择是否展示具体搜索步骤; 程序输出在该搜索方法下的最佳路径以及使用该搜索方法的搜索步骤数;
1
【问题描述】 很多涉及图上操作的算法都是以图的遍历操作为基础的。试写一个程序,演示在连通的有向图上访问全部结点的操作。 【基本要求】 以邻接表为存储结构,实现创建图、销毁图、查找顶点、获取顶点值、顶点赋值、获得第一邻接点、获得下一邻接点、插入顶点、删除顶点、插入弧、删除弧、深度优先搜索遍历、广深度优先搜索遍历等操作 注: 1.系统设计 2.系统主界面演示系统设计:包含欢迎菜单为新建表、打开文件、退出程序 3.操作界面设计:创建图、销毁图、查找顶点、获取顶点值、顶点赋值、获得第一邻接点、获得下一邻接点、插入顶点、删除顶点、插入弧、删除弧、深度优先搜索遍历、广深度优先搜索遍历等13个 3.代码中有三个头文件,1个主函数;共700行代码,是一个完整的系统设计 4.代码进行了多次调试与运行,绝对可以编译并执行。 5.软件用VS2019打开
2021-07-12 19:05:03 12.09MB C c++ 深度遍历和广度遍历
图遍历的演示 【问题描述】 很多涉及图上操作的算法都是以图的遍历操作为基础的。试写一个程序,演示在连通的无向图上访问全部结点的操作。 【基本要求】 以邻接表为存储结构,实现连通无向图的深度优先和广度优先遍历。以用户指定的结点为起点,分别输出每种遍历下的结点访问序列和相应生成树的边集。 注: 1.代码共182行。 2.代码经过多次编译运行,无错误。
2021-07-12 19:05:01 1KB C C++ 无向图 深度优先和广度优先
for (j = 1; j <= Pub.Vertexnum; j++) { if (Pub.color[j] == -1) Pub.color[j] = 0; for (i = 1; i <= Pub.Vertexnum; i++) { if (Pub.graphs[j, i] == 1) { if (Pub.color[i] == -1) { Pub.color[i] = 1 - Pub.color[j]; } else if (Pub.color[j] == Pub.color[i]) { return false; } } } } if (Pub.Vertexnum != 0 &&j==Pub.Vertexnum + 1) { return true; } else return false;
2021-07-03 19:56:36 34KB 二分图
1
主要介绍了C语言使用广度优先搜索算法解决迷宫问题,结合迷宫问题分析了C语言队列广度优先搜索算法的相关使用技巧,需要的朋友可以参考下
2021-07-03 13:50:58 60KB C语言 广度优先搜索 算法 迷宫问题
1
vc6编译器编译,C语言写的代码,老鼠走迷宫,用广度优先的寻找最短的路径算法,遍历全部路径使用的是深度算法。完整代码可直接下载调试运行。
1